I solve all psychological problems that poker causes the same way. I talk to someone who doesn't play poker and explain the problem.

They usually are totally shocked by whatever I have to say. So, in this example it'd be "OMG you made $x in one tournament!!!" or "OMG you would've made $y more if a K hadn't come on the river!!" or whatever.

Inevitably, when they start telling me that poker is horrible and I should quit and/or poker is awesome and I should drop out of school to make $1B/year, I start to correct them and explain that this stuff is totally normal and it all balances out to a nice decent salary in the end, and that good poker players are able to deal with this stuff. In the process, I usually convince myself that this is true.. at least temporarily.
